Description
Savory-sweet individual cups with a creamy cottage cheese base and a hidden molten miso honey center that oozes delightfully when broken into.
Ingredients
Scale
For the Crust:
- 1 cup full-fat cottage cheese
- 2 tablespoons white miso paste
- 3 tablespoons honey
- 1 large egg
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 tablespoon melted butter
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- Fresh chives for garnish
Instructions
1. Prepare the Crust:
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ease four ramekins or oven-safe cups lightly with butter or oil.
- In a small bowl, mix miso paste and honey until smooth to create the molten core. Set aside.
- In a medium bowl, combine cottage cheese, egg, melted butter, and black pepper. Whisk until mostly smooth.
- Add Parmesan cheese, flour, and baking powder to the cottage cheese mixture. Stir until just combined.
- Divide half of the batter evenly among the prepared ramekins. Make a small well in the center of each.
- Place a spoonful of the miso honey mixture into each well, ensuring it’s centered and not touching the edges.
- Top with the remaining batter, sealing the edges to encase the miso honey core completely.
- Bake for 18-20 minutes, until the tops are golden and set but the center is still slightly jiggly.
- Let cool for 5 minutes, then garnish with fresh chives and serve warm.
